Output 138aaf21fa7b3ea130125720dfc4cb0278d26561c16029476a96882ee62644bb:106

value
348178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8fd156a5bc9413c0eba983d5b4653e77d4337e6 OP_EQUAL
address
3H6YdLCYEZHHNs8jA9jxmKKJuNpN8RRaF8
transaction
138aaf21fa7b3ea130125720dfc4cb0278d26561c16029476a96882ee62644bb